Scanning pattern of diffusion tensor tractography and an analysis of the morphology and function of spinal nerve roots

查看全文 作  者:Xin [1]Tian;Huaijun [1]Liu;Zuojun [1]Geng;Hua [1]Yang;Guoshi [1]Wang;Jiping [1]Yang;Chunxia [1]Wang;Cuining [1]Li;Ying [1]Li 高影响力作者 机构地区:[1]Department of Medical Imaging,the Second Hospital of Hebei Medical University高影响力机构 出  处:《Neural Regeneration Research》索引2013年第8卷第33期,共8页高影响力期刊 基  金:supported by the Instruction Project of Health Department of Hebei Province of China in 2012,No.20120072 摘  要:Radiculopathy,commonly induced by intervertebral disk bulging or protrusion,is presently diagnosed in accordance with clinical symptoms because there is no objective quantitative diagnostic criterion.Diffusion tensor magnetic resonance imaging and diffusion tensor tractography revealed the characterization of anisotropic diffusion and displayed the anatomic form of nerve root fibers This study included 18 cases with intervertebral disc degeneration-induced unilateral radiculopathy Magnetic resonance diffusion tensor imaging was creatively used to reveal the scanning pattern o fiber tracking of the spinal nerve root.A scoring system of nerve root morphology was used to quantitatively assess nerve root morphology and functional alteration after intervertebral disc degeneration.Results showed that after fiber tracking,compared with unaffected nerve root,fiber bundles gathered together and interrupted at the affected side.No significant alteration was detected in the number of fiber bundles,but the cross-sectional area of nerve root fibers was reduced These results suggest that diffusion tensor magnetic resonance imaging-based tractography can be used to quantitatively evaluate nerve root function according to the area and morphology of fiber bundles of nerve roots. 关 键 词:跟踪技术 扩散张量 解剖形态 脊神经 扫描模式 弥散 磁共振成像 各向异性扩散
